 Configure ue-dns
 ################
 
-For UE-DNS, you are required to generate a Helm value for the new cluster.
-You can use the same ``Makefile`` that you used for generating the runtime configs for this.
+For UE-DNS, you are required to create Helm values for the new cluster.
+You'll need cluster domain and kube-dns ClusterIP address. Both can be found in
+``aether-pod-configs/production/cluster_map.tfvars``.
+Be sure to replace ``[ ]`` in the example configuration below to the actual cluster value.
